Leh: The virtual launch of ‘Ayushman Bhava’ by President Draupadi Murmu was witnessed by Naib Tehsildar Chuchot, Sarpanch Chuchot Shamma, Nambardar Chuchot Shamma, Member Women’s Alliance Chuchot, and a multitude of dedicated individuals.

Among the attendees were the staff of HWC PHC, Medical Officer ICDS, Block Medical Officer, local residents, and ASHAs, all of whom joined in celebrating this significant healthcare initiative.

Naib Tehsildar, Attaullah addressed the gathering, shedding light on the vital task of including individuals who are not accounted for in the census. He assured the attendees of plans to organise a camp in collaboration with the health department to rectify this issue.

Block Medical Officer, Dr. Rinchen provided an insightful briefing on ‘Ayushman Apke Dwar 3.0,’ emphasizing the significance of the Ayushman Health Mela and Ayushman Sabha in reaching out to communities and delivering essential healthcare services.

All participants and PRIs expressed their commitment to supporting and cooperating with the Ayushman Bhava initiative.

The event concluded with the National Anthem, symbolizing the unity and commitment of all present towards the cause of healthcare accessibility and inclusivity.

In a significant milestone for healthcare accessibility, the virtual inauguration of ‘Ayushman Bhava’ by the President of India, Droupadi Murmu was witnessed today at the Community Health Center (CHC) in Khaltse.

The event saw the presence of esteemed officials and dedicated individuals, including Incharge SDM, Khaltse, Tanveer Ahmad; Block Medical Officer, Khaltse, Dr. Nurboo Angchuk; Block Development Officer, Khaltse, Pankaj Rajput; Zonal Education Officer, Khaltse, along with PRIs, paramedical staff, and members from ICDS.
